Back to Parts List

Volkswagen TOUAREG 3.0 TDI CR ECU (Engine Management) - Part No: 7P0907311C / 0281018303

OEM no: 0281018303 / 0 281 018 303 - Volkswagen TOUAREG - ECU (Engine Management) zoom

Send your own unit for rebuild

(Excludes VAT @ 20%)
Return Shipping £
Turnaround time 2-3 working days
Programming see details
Rebuild Details full details

PRODUCT INFORMATION

Vehicle Details:

MakeVolkswagen ModelTOUAREG Engine Size:3.0 SpecificationTDI CR Years:2011 - 2014

Common Faults:

The Volkswagen Touareg, manufactured between 2011 to 2014, is known to suffer from a commonly failing ECU, leading to non-start of the vehicle. Further symptoms of a faulty ECU include injector problems that will result in stored fault codes P0651 - Sensor Voltage B Open Circuit, P2146 - Fuel Injector Group A - Supply Voltage Circuit Open, or P2149 - Injection Values Bank 2 - Power Supply Open C. If I purchase this will it cure my fault?

Part Numbers:

VM no: 7P0907311C / 7P0 907 311 C OEM no: 0281018303 / 0 281 018 303

Warranty:

Lifetime Warranty*, unlimited mileage
Product Code: EEM018303

RELATED PRODUCTS

Volkswagen TOUAREG - OEM no

Part Number:

070906016D / 0281010736

Volkswagen TOUAREG

Engine Size: 4.9

Years: 2003 - 2007

 

Volkswagen TOUAREG - OEM no

Part Number:

070906016F / 0281011258

Volkswagen TOUAREG

Engine Size: 2.5

Years: 2003 - 2006

 

Volkswagen TOUAREG - OEM no

Part Number:

070906016AA / 0281011481

Volkswagen TOUAREG

Engine Size: 5.0

Years: 2002 - 2006

1 reviews

Volkswagen TOUAREG - OEM no

Part Number:

070906016AJ / 0281011568

Volkswagen TOUAREG

Engine Size: 2.5

Years: 2003 - 2007

 

Volkswagen TOUAREG - OEM no

Part Number:

070906016BL / 0281011859

Volkswagen TOUAREG

Engine Size: 2.5

Years: 2003 - 2006

 

Volkswagen TOUAREG - OEM no

Part Number:

7L0907401 / 0281011960

Volkswagen TOUAREG

Engine Size: 3.0

Years: 2004 - 2006

 

Volkswagen TOUAREG - OEM no

Part Number:

070906016BT / 0281012644

Volkswagen TOUAREG

Engine Size: 2.5

Years: 2006 - 2010

 

Volkswagen TOUAREG - OEM no

Part Number:

7L0907401B / 0281012773

Volkswagen TOUAREG

Engine Size: 3.0

Years: 2005 - 2008

 

Volkswagen TOUAREG - OEM no

Part Number:

070906016DA / 0281012933

Volkswagen TOUAREG

Engine Size: 2.5

Years: 2003 - 2007

 

Volkswagen TOUAREG - OEM no

Part Number:

070906016DE / 0281013302

Volkswagen TOUAREG

Engine Size: 2.5

Years: 2006 - 2010

 

Volkswagen TOUAREG - OEM no

Part Number:

7L0907401C / 0281013322

Volkswagen TOUAREG

Engine Size: 3.0

Years: 2004 - 2006

 

Volkswagen TOUAREG - OEM no

Part Number:

7l0907401D / 0281013686

Volkswagen TOUAREG

Engine Size: 3.0

Years: 2005 - 2008

 

Volkswagen TOUAREG - OEM no

Part Number:

7L0907401F / 0281013692

Volkswagen TOUAREG

Engine Size: 3.0

Years: 2005 - 2008

 

Volkswagen TOUAREG - OEM no

Part Number:

7P0907401F / 0281017733

Volkswagen TOUAREG

Engine Size: 3.0

Years: 2011 - 2014

 

Volkswagen TOUAREG - OEM no

Part Number:

7P1907401 / 0281031185

Volkswagen TOUAREG

Engine Size: 3.0

Years: 2014 - 2018

 

Volkswagen TOUAREG - OEM no

Part Number:

7P1907401F / 0281032818

Volkswagen TOUAREG

Engine Size: 3.0

Years: 2014 - 2018